BBC iPlayer

One of the most famous among the entertainment apps. This free app allows its’ users to view and cat-up with most of the BBC networks’ shows, stream videos and listen to the radio on the go. The strong and the wide archive of content keeps users entertained for an unlimited amount of time.

BBC iPlayer comes free in both Android and iOS version and its available through iTunes and Google Play.

Kobo

Kobo is a well-known eBook reader app among all the mobile users. Even the iOS users likes to replace the default iBooks app with this one because Kobo makes reading fun. It gives out badges and rewards as you completes reading achievements and also lets users to keep a log of their reading history. Kobo has a base of over 1 million free eBooks.

Kobo app is available free for Android and iOS. It can be downloaded from iTunes and Google Play.

NFB Films

NFB Films app is brought to you by the National Film Board of Canada. This app lets you choose from more than 1000 film titles and stream them right on your mobile device for free. You can only watch Canadian content but there are lots of fun things to watch there. You wont regret installing this app.

NFB Films app is free and is available for iPhone and iPad as well as Android devices.

TV Catchup

This app lets you select from over 50 popular UK channels and stream free-to-view shows on your mobile device. Users can choose from channels including BBC One, ITV, Channel 4, Five, Dave, CBeebies, 4Music and many more.

TV Catchup app is available for iOS devices but it’s still not available on Android. You can download the app from iTunes for free.
